跳到主要内容

工作流节点--更新外部用户信息


节点功能: 通过此节点,可以直接更新外部用户的账户信息,如姓名、角色、可用状态,以及自定义的收集信息。

外部用户状态只能从正常/停用改为停用/正常,当为未激活时不能更改。

场景示例: 如下图,单独建立一张工作表来维护外部用户信息,进行邀请、审核、调整角色和状态等管理,如当在表中调整某用户的状态后,同步到外部用户账户中。

1、创建工作流

2、获取外部用户

添加“获取单条外部人员数据”节点,来获取相应的外部人员。有两种方式获取,可以通过手机号从外部用户列表中查询获取,也可以直接通过记录中从外部用户字段获取。

  • 从外部用户字段获取

    如下图配置,直接从记录中成员字段获取,因为成员字段选择的就是外部账户。

  • 从外部门户中获取

    从外部门户获取,就需要根据一个唯一信息查询了。此处我们通过手机号查询

    • 如果有多个人员匹配,则获取到最新注册的人员信息

    • 如勾选随机获取后,则从多条匹配人员中随机获取一条人员信息

3、更新外部用户信息

外部用户信息获取后,添加“更新外部用户信息”节点,可以直接更改外部用户的账户信息。如更改其姓名、角色、可用状态等系统字段,也可以更改自定义的信息收集字段。